Diana Anaid, stage name of Diana Gosper, is an Australian singer-songwriter. Born in Sydney, she began her musical career at the age of 16, releasing her first independent album in 2014. Her music style is characterized by folk, indie and pop influences, with introspective lyrics exploring themes such as love, loss and personal growth. Among her most notable songs are "The Light", "Golden Hour" and "Wild Heart". In 2018 she released her second album, "Echoes", which received positive reviews from the Australian music critics. Diana Anaid is considered one of the emerging voices in the Australian indie music scene.
